• dustin trench

    Regular price £357.00 SHP
    Sale price £357.00 SHP Regular price £510 -30%
    0123
  • desmond jacket

    Regular price £135.00 SHP
    Sale price £135.00 SHP Regular price £269 -50%
    0123
  • charlize jacket

    Regular price £181.00 SHP
    Sale price £181.00 SHP Regular price £302 -40%
    3436384042
  • dilly jacket

    Regular price £227.00 SHP
    Sale price £227.00 SHP Regular price £379 -40%
    3436384042
  • tomari jacket

    Regular price £198.00 SHP
    Sale price £198.00 SHP Regular price £247 -20%
    0123
  • patchouli jacket

    Regular price £285.00 SHP
    Sale price £285.00 SHP Regular price £357 -20%
    0123
  • anemone jacket

    Regular price £129.00 SHP
    Sale price £129.00 SHP Regular price £214 -40%
    0123
  • dandy jacket

    Regular price £265.00 SHP
    Sale price £265.00 SHP Regular price £379 -30%
    3436384042
  • elite coat

    Regular price £217.00 SHP
    Sale price £217.00 SHP Regular price £433 -50%
    3436384042
  • domingo jacket

    Regular price £320.00 SHP
    Sale price £320.00 SHP Regular price £400 -20%
    3436384042
  • drew jacket

    Regular price £227.00 SHP
    Sale price £227.00 SHP Regular price £379 -40%
    3436384042
  • darhan jacket

    Regular price £194.00 SHP
    Sale price £194.00 SHP Regular price £324 -40%
    3436384042
  • evasion jacket

    Regular price £285.00 SHP
    Sale price £285.00 SHP Regular price £357 -20%
    123
  • duomo jacket

    Regular price £610.00 SHP
    Sale price £610.00 SHP Regular price £762 -20%
    0123
  • eclipse jacket

    Regular price £227.00 SHP
    Sale price £227.00 SHP Regular price £379 -40%
    0123
  • clemence jacket

    Regular price £162.00 SHP
    Sale price £162.00 SHP Regular price £324 -50%
    3436384042
  • dino trench

    Regular price £313.00 SHP
    Sale price £313.00 SHP Regular price £521 -40%
    0123
  • dune jacket

    Regular price £265.00 SHP
    Sale price £265.00 SHP Regular price £379 -30%
    3436384042

Next: Dresses